The CDC Guide To Breastfeeding Interventions

The CDC Guide To Breastfeeding InterventionsThe CDC Guide To Breastfeeding Interventions provides state and local community members information to choose the breastfeeding intervention strategy that best meets their needs. Support for breastfeeding is needed in many different arenas, including worksites, medical systems, and family settings. The Guide builds upon the research evidence demonstrating effective interventions as well as the expertise of the nation’s leading scientists and experts in breastfeeding management and interventions.
